About the role

The Lead Analyst – MA CIAC Policy & Procedure provides technical leadership for Massachusetts electric and gas connections, focusing on how customer construction costs are calculated and applied when new utility assets are added. This role ensures CIAC governance aligns with Massachusetts regulatory requirements, National Grid policies, and rate case obligations, while maintaining consistency with CIAC governance frameworks used across jurisdictions, including New York.

Responsibilities

  • Provide lead-level ownership of MA CIAC policy, procedures, and governance for electric and gas.
  • Chair the MA Electric and MA Gas CIAC Committees and the MA CIAC Performance Forum in accordance with established charters.
  • Lead and/or support MA CIAC regulatory activities, including rate cases, filings, audits, information requests, and customer complaints.
  • Develop, train, maintain, and communicate CIAC policies and guidance that are clear, defensible, and regulator ready.
  • Serve as a technical consultant on complex CIAC matters across Connections, Design, DPAM, Pricing, Account Management, and other stakeholders.
  • Partner with Legal, Regulatory, Pricing, Compliance, and Capital Accounting to ensure accurate tariff and order interpretation and application of CIAC requirements.
  • Utilize AI-enabled tools (e.g., Microsoft Copilot and approved enterprise AI platforms) to support regulatory analysis, policy drafting, training content development, and knowledge management.
